A lively brush-script with a pronounced rightward slant and energetic stroke modulation. Letterforms are built from broad, tapered strokes that end in sharp points and occasional spur-like terminals, giving the silhouettes a punchy, inked feel. Counters are generally compact, curves are full and rounded, and many capitals feature subtle entry/exit swashes that add momentum without becoming overly ornate. Overall spacing and widths vary naturally, reinforcing a hand-drawn rhythm while keeping forms legible at display sizes.
Well-suited to short, high-impact text such as logos, poster headlines, product packaging, social graphics, and apparel lettering where a bold handwritten voice is desirable. It will be most effective when given enough size and breathing room to preserve the tapered terminals and lively stroke detail.
The font reads bold and charismatic, with a spirited, vintage-leaning brush aesthetic. Its quick, gestural shapes suggest motion and spontaneity, making it feel friendly and attention-grabbing rather than formal.
Likely designed to capture the look of fast brush lettering in a polished, repeatable form—combining dramatic thick–thin contrast, slanted motion, and slightly condensed counters to create strong display presence.
Capitals are especially prominent and graphic, with thickened bowls and angled joins that create strong word shapes. Numerals match the script energy with tilted, tapered strokes and compact curves, maintaining stylistic consistency across the set.
